First, understanding the types of construction loans is crucial for residential and commercial builds. These may include one-time close loans, which combine construction and permanent financing, or two-time close loans that involve separate processes for building and long-term mortgages. Calculating Loan Payments for Construction

In the 93287 Zip Code area of California, estimating your construction loan payments involves understanding key methods based on loan amount, interest rates, and terms. For instance, monthly payments are typically calculated using amortization formulas that factor in the principal, interest, and the loan duration.

Several factors can affect these costs, including fluctuating interest rates, which are influenced by market conditions, and project timelines, as construction loans often feature interest-only payments during the building phase. It’s essential to account for these variables to avoid unexpected expenses.

Specific Considerations for 93287 Zip Code

When pursuing construction loans in the 93287 Zip Code area of California, it's essential to understand the local regulations and requirements that can influence your project. In Kern County, builders must comply with specific building codes, zoning laws, and permit processes enforced by local authorities. For instance, projects may require approvals for seismic standards due to California's earthquake-prone regions, as well as environmental assessments for rural areas like Woody.
